#7ab665 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ab665 is composed of 47.8% red, 71.4%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.5%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 104.4 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 55.5%. #7ab665 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ffca with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7ab665 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7ab665 has RGB values of R:122, G:182,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 8042085.

Hex triplet 7ab665 #7ab665
RGB Decimal 122, 182, 101 rgb(122,182,101)
RGB Percent 47.8, 71.4, 39.6 rgb(47.8%,71.4%,39.6%)
CMYK 33, 0, 45, 29
HSL 104.4°, 35.7, 55.5 hsl(104.4,35.7%,55.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 104.4°, 44.5, 71.4
Web Safe 66cc66 #66cc66
CIE-LAB 68.411, -34.743, 35.122
XYZ 27.102, 38.532, 18.321
xyY 0.323, 0.459, 38.532
CIE-LCH 68.411, 49.403, 134.689
CIE-LUV 68.411, -29.879, 50.75
Hunter-Lab 62.074, -30.696, 25.953
Binary 01111010, 10110110, 01100101

Shades and Tints of #7ab665

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030603 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ab665

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9388 is the less saturated color, while #58fc1f is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#7ab665 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9b9b9b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#94a090 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#bbab67 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#cca474 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#90b0bd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a3af66 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#aeaa6e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#88b29d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
